Housecall Pro alternatives for septic companies

Housecall Pro is field service software for home-service contractors, including some septic companies that already run HVAC, plumbing, or cleaning in the same shop. It is strong on estimates, marketing automation, and customer messaging. It is not a tank, manifest, or trip-ticket system.

If Housecall Pro is mainly your calendar and invoice tool, the alternatives below are the septic-specific products in our directory—not a second horizontal suite. Pricing on Housecall Pro is published per user and billed annually on the listed plans; several septic vendors publish truck-count or flat rates instead, and a few remain quote-only.

Why septic companies look beyond Housecall Pro

What Housecall Pro does well

  • Good/better/best estimates and a price book
  • Marketing automation and customer communication
  • Digital invoicing, reminders, and online payments
  • GPS tracking and QuickBooks on Essentials+
  • Published per-user pricing and a 14-day trial

What septic work requires

  • Tank-per-property records with service history
  • Pumping frequency tracking per tank
  • State-specific trip tickets and manifests
  • Disposal site tracking and compliance
  • Land application logs (where applicable)

Housecall Pro can schedule and invoice pump-outs, but manifests, trip tickets, and tank history still need a workaround. Septic-specific platforms include those workflows instead of treating them as custom fields.

Quick Comparison: Horizontal vs. Septic-Specific

FeatureHousecall Pro / JobberSeptic-Specific Tools
Tank records per propertyNo — custom fields (workaround)Yes — built-in
Service history by tankNo — not availableYes — built-in
State trip ticketsNo — manual / externalYes — auto-generated
Disposal manifestsNo — not availableYes — built-in
Pumping frequency trackingNo — manual / spreadsheetYes — automated
Route optimizationYesYes — often tank-aware
QuickBooks syncYesYes — most platforms
Mobile appYesYes — often offline-capable

When Housecall Pro makes sense

Housecall Pro (or Jobber) can work for septic companies that:

  • Mix septic with other home-service trades in one office
  • Need marketing, reviews, and packaged estimates more than tank records
  • Operate where compliance paperwork is still handled outside the FSM
  • Want published per-user pricing and a short trial before switching stacks

Dedicated pump-out and hauler operations—especially in TX, FL, NC, NY, and PA—usually outgrow a horizontal tool once drivers need tank history and county paperwork in the same closeout flow.

Frequently asked questions

Does Housecall Pro have septic features?
Housecall Pro lists septic among the trades it serves, but the product is generic field service: scheduling, estimates, invoicing, and marketing. Our notes show no tank records, manifests, or state-specific trip tickets. Those require external tools or spreadsheets.
How does Housecall Pro pricing compare?
Housecall Pro publishes $59 / $149 / $299 per month for Basic, Essentials, and MAX when billed annually, with user caps (1 / 5 / 8) and a 14-day trial. Septic-specific tools are priced differently: some by truck-count tier, some flat, some quote-only. Do not convert those models into a fake per-user equivalent.
Is Jobber a Housecall Pro alternative for septic?
Jobber is a peer horizontal product, not a septic-specific alternative. If the problem is compliance and tank history, switching from Housecall Pro to Jobber does not close the gap. Use the Jobber alternatives page for the same septic-specific shortlist from the other horizontal starting point.
